【C# 利用SendMessage实现winform与wpf之间的消息传递】教程文章相关的互联网学习教程文章

JS实现按比例缩放图片的方法(附C#版代码)_javascript技巧

本文实例讲述了JS实现按比例缩放图片的方法。分享给大家供大家参考,具体如下: js版本:function resizeImage(obj, MaxW, MaxH) {var imageObject = obj;var state = imageObject.readyState;if(state!='complete') {setTimeout("resizeImage("+imageObject+","+MaxW+","+MaxH+")",50);return;}var oldImage = new Image();oldImage.src = imageObject.src;var dW = oldImage.width; var dH = oldImage.height;if(dW>MaxW || dH>M...

js实现C#的StringBuilder效果完整实例_javascript技巧

本文实例讲述了js实现C#的StringBuilder效果。分享给大家供大家参考,具体如下:/*##################### DO NOT MODIFY THIS HEADER ###################### Title: StringBuilder Class ## Description: Simulates the C# StringBuilder Class in Javascript. ## Author: Adam Smith ## Email: ibulwark@hotmail.com ## Date: November 12, 2006 ...

C#实现将一个字符转换为整数【图】

按标题的要求将一个字符转换为整数。实现此功能,也有好几个方法 方法一:Convert.ToInt32(string);运行代码:方法二: int.Parse(object):运行结果:这个字符正好是数字的字符串,使用int.Parse()是没有任何问题,但是如果这个是非数字的字符串呢?运行时,出现异常了:方法三:Int.TryParse(obj) 此方法,可以很好解决方法的异常问题,如异常抛出时,它返回0:运行结果:经过上面的各种方法或是运行的情况,我们是否有一个综合性...

微信小程序支付之c#后台实现方法【图】

微信小程序支付c#后台实现今天为大家带来比较简单的支付后台处理 首先下载官方的c#模板(WxPayAPI),将模板(WxPayAPI)添加到服务器上,然后在WxPayAPI项目目录中添加两个“一般处理程序” (改名为GetOpenid.ashx、pay.ashx) 之后打开business目录下的JsApiPay.cs,在JsApiPay.cs中修改如下两处然后在GetOpenid.ashx中加入代码如下: public class GetOpenid : IHttpHandler { public string openid { get; set; } public void...

jQuery+C#实现参数RSA加密传输功能【附jsencrypt.js下载】

本文实例讲述了jQuery+C#实现参数RSA加密传输功能。分享给大家供大家参考,具体如下: 注意: 参数传递的+号处理,在传输时会把+变成空格,不处理后端就报错了。 1、前端代码 <!DOCTYPE html> <html> <head><meta name="viewport" content="width=device-width" /><title>Login</title><script src="jquery-1.10.2.min.js"></script><script src="jsencrypt.min.js"></script><script type="text/javascript">$(function () {var e...

php和C#的yield迭代器实现方法对比分析

本文实例讲述了php和C#的yield迭代器实现方法对比。分享给大家供大家参考,具体如下: yield关键字是用来方便实现迭代器的,免去了手工写迭代器的繁琐。迭代器常被用来实现协程,所以大部分的协程中都有yield关键字,可以参看unity3D的协程。 C#版本: 函数的返回类型必须为 IEnumerable、IEnumerable<T>、IEnumerator 或 IEnumerator<T>。 IEnumerable表示一个类可以迭代,也就是可以用foreach遍历,IEnumerator是真正的迭代器实现...

js实现C#的StringBuilder效果完整实例

本文实例讲述了js实现C#的StringBuilder效果。分享给大家供大家参考,具体如下: /*##################### DO NOT MODIFY THIS HEADER ###################### Title: StringBuilder Class ## Description: Simulates the C# StringBuilder Class in Javascript. ## Author: Adam Smith ## Email: ibulwark@hotmail.com ## Date: November 12, 2006 ...

JS实现按比例缩放图片的方法(附C#版代码)

本文实例讲述了JS实现按比例缩放图片的方法。分享给大家供大家参考,具体如下: js版本: function resizeImage(obj, MaxW, MaxH) {var imageObject = obj;var state = imageObject.readyState;if(state!=complete) {setTimeout("resizeImage("+imageObject+","+MaxW+","+MaxH+")",50);return;}var oldImage = new Image();oldImage.src = imageObject.src;var dW = oldImage.width; var dH = oldImage.height;if(dW>MaxW || dH>Ma...

javascript模拟实现C# String.format函数功能代码

C# string.format这个功能用到的地方比较多, 所以就用js实现了一个简单的版本 :代码如下:String.format = function () { var formatStr = arguments[0]; if ( typeof formatStr === string ) { var pattern, length = arguments.length; for ( var i = 1; i < length; i++ ) { pattern = new Re...

JavaScript打开word文档的实现代码(c#)

在C#中打开word文档其实不算太难,方法也比较多。 一.C#中打开word文档方法 代码如下://在项目引用里添加上对Microsoft Word 11.0 object library的引用 private void button1_Click(object sender, System.EventArgs e) { //调用打开文件对话框获取要打开的文件WORD文件,RTF文件,文本文件路径名称 OpenFileDialog opd = new OpenFileDialog(); opd.InitialDirectory = \"c:\\\\\"; opd.Filter = \"Word文档(*.doc)|*.doc|文本文...

c#和Javascript操作同一json对象的实现代码

能否让客户端和服务端操作同一json对象呢?目前想到的方式是通过客户端隐藏控件来实现。 以下是一个泛型列表对象 List<TrainingImplement> ,转为json后,客户端和服务端如何操作 1、json对象与C#泛型相互转换代码 代码如下://将json数据转换为泛型 public static T ConvertByteDataToObject<T>(string byteData) { T obj; using (var ms = new MemoryStream(Encoding.UTF8.GetBytes(byteData))) { var serializer = new DataCont...

C#中TrimStart,TrimEnd,Trim在javascript上的实现

于是乎,自己动手写了个!!看到很多人都是用正则,咱不会,就用了最土的方法来实现了!帖上代码吧!希望对大家有所帮助!!! 代码如下:String.prototype.trimStart = function(trimStr){ if(!trimStr){return this;} var temp = this; while(true){ if(temp.substr(0,trimStr.length)!=trimStr){ break; } temp = temp.substr(trimStr.length); } return temp; }; String.prototype.trimEnd = function(trimStr){ if(!trimStr){return thi...

javascript实现的像java、c#之类的sleep暂停的函数代码

下面就是我的实现的方法: 代码 代码如下:<script type="text/javascript"> function test() { var s="javascript--暂停函数"; setTimeout( function(){ eval(sleep(test)); //执行return之后的代码,也就是“alert(s);” }, 2000 ); //两秒后执行 return; //运行到这就退出 alert(s); } function sleep(func) { if (func == null) { return ; } var reg= /[\n\r]/g; var funcStr = func.toString().replace(reg,); //替换回车和...

js 模拟实现类似c#下的hashtable的简单功能代码

如果在c#中,我们只要用hashtable或者dictionary根据key取value的特性,就可以很轻松地实现这个功能了。其实我们稍作处理,js也可以实现类似hashtable的功能。下面总结一下笔者开发中用到的实现方式,贴代码为主。 1、实现思路:主要就是利用原型(prototype)的hasOwnProperty方法,确定对象中的项是该添加、移除还是取出某个匹配的项等。hasOwnProperty比遍历数组取值灵巧快速的地方在于:至少从代码上来看,它是O(1)复杂度的。 ...

JS中简单的实现像C#中using功能(有源码下载)【图】

先看看使用页面是如何调用的。 代码如下:<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<title> neverModules Using Function - http://www.never-online.net </title> <meta http-equiv="ImageToolbar" content="no" /> <meta name="author" content="never-online, BlueDestiny"/> <meta n...